Page 2: Chapter Plan Challenge — Brown

Campus Background• First Year with a Nourish International Chapter• Small University

– 6,000 student total– Globally conscious student body– Very active and supportive of student initiative

• Potential Partners– Sustainable Food Initiative– Farmer’s Market located on campus– Darfur Action Network– UNICEF

• Competition– Chiapas Initiative

Page 4: Chapter Plan Challenge — Brown

Goals• Obtain university membership and awareness• Recruit 3 positive underclassmen leaders for the

executive board making 7 total • Gain 5-10 dedicated and motivated members• Establish weekly profitable ($50-$100) hunger

lunches• Start up cuddle buddies venture at Farmers Market• Fundraising Goal: $2,000• Pick an International Project, establish an

International Project Committee and go on a summer trip
